Climate Overview

🇺🇸

Austin

Austin at the Texas Hill Country edge has a subtropical semi-arid climate with extreme summer heat. The Colorado River creates Lady Bird Lake, a cooling feature in the city center. Winter Storm Uri in 2021 killed hundreds and left millions without power for days, exposing infrastructure vulnerability. Austin's rapid growth has created one of America's fastest-intensifying urban heat islands.

🇭🇰

Hong Kong

Humid subtropical — hot wet summers, mild dry winters, typhoon season

Best monthsOctober, November, December, March
AvoidJuly, August, September (typhoons and extreme heat)
Annual rain88 inches (2,224 mm)

Hong Kong has a dramatic climate shaped by the South China Sea and its mountainous terrain. Winters are mild and dry; summers are brutal with typhoons. The autumn window (October–December) is widely considered the best time to visit.
